14. The resulting window should look similar to Figure 4-18.
Figure 4-18: User Data Entry Window with User Information
15. Click on the button. If the user data is not saved before clicking any other button or exiting
the User Data window, the data entered is lost and must be re-entered.
NOTE: If you have enabled badging (see “Enable Badging in Doors” on page 15 in section 9), a photo
window will appear in the lower right corner of the User Data window. Once a photo has been
associated with the user (see “Acquire and Edit User Photo” on page 20 in section 9), that photo will
show in the photo window (see Figure 4-18).
16. Now update the access control network with the new information. Click on the button on
the tool bar (for details on the update process refer to “Update the Network” on page 35 in
section 5).
